“…Interferences of seasonality on the bioaccumulation of trace metals in P. perna mussels may have different profiles depending on the study region and survey period. Ferreira et al (2004), when evaluating P. perna mussels in three beaches in the northern coast of Rio de Janeiro, did not find a seasonal trend of accumulation.…”
